Object documentationOrganizational Unit-Related Parameters - Planning Grid

 

Using the following OU-related parameter the system administrator can influence the functionality of the planning grid (time-based planning).

Structure

N1PTART

The time grid of the planning grid displays a horizontal line every x minutes. With this parameter you determine the value of x. You define the parameter for the planning OU.

For the parameter value you can use all whole numbers that are factors of 60, i.e. 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 10, 12, 15, 30 and 60. The value 10 (10 minutes) is set as the default.

N1PTAST

You can use this parameter to control the spacing between the two horizontal lines of the time grid in the planning grid. You must enter the value in the resolution-independent Twips unit. You define the parameter for the planning OU.

Example Example

A value of 250 on a 17 inch monitor with a resolution 1024x768 pixels this represents a space of approximately 4 millimeters. 250 is set as the default.

End of the example.
N1PTCS

You can use this parameter to determine how often the system should attempt to find replacement days for days which are not displayed in the planning grid (days with neither time slots not planning authority).

This parameter is only relevant when you use a display variant of the planning grid with the option Days with Timeslot or Days with Planning Authority.

N1PTBKED

You use this parameter to determine whether an appointment should be planned in the planning grid with or without the processing dialog box.

You define the parameter for the planning OU.

  • X: Plan appointment with processing dialog box

  • Space: Plan appointment without processing dialog box (standard value)

    Note Note

    This parameter is also relevant when moving an appointment block. If you set the parameter value to X, the user will access the dialog box to move an appointment block.

    See Moving an Appointment Block.

    End of the note.
N1PGMSM

You can use this parameter to control whether collective processing of appointments occurs in the planning grid with or without a dialog box.

  • 1: Collective processing without a dialog box

  • 2: Collective processing with a dialog box

  • Space: Use parameter value of parameter N1PTBKED (standard value)

N1PGTMPL

You use this parameter to determine whether an appointment should be created with a template in the planning grid with or without the processing dialog box.

You define the parameter for the planning OU.

  • 1: Create appointment with template without processing dialog box

  • 2: Create appointment with template without processing dialog box

  • Space: Use parameter value of parameter N1PTBKED (standard value), i.e. the behavior of the system is derived from parameter N1PTBKED

N1PTEL

With this parameter you can determine whether the system should expand the worklist tree down to the service level when the planning grid is called:

  • X: Expand services

  • Space: Do not expand services (standard value).

N1PTMODE

With this parameter you define the preferred mode (display of the multi-planning tools) for the planning grid:

  • 1: OU-related display, i.e. there is one tab page for each OU

  • 2: Date-related display, i.e. there is one tab page for each day

    Note Note

    This system will not take this parameter into account when calling the planning grid with display variants, since the setting is made in the display variant.

    End of the note.
N1PTOANZ

With the OU parameter N1PTOANZ you define whether the system should also display the working hours of the OUs and rooms in the time grid, as well as the schedulable times. This entry is then valid for the planning OU.

  • X: Display opening times

  • Space: Do not display opening times

N1PTRCHS

When you call the planning grid, the system will highlight the first patient in the worklist as standard. In the OU-related display, the planning grid will simultaneously offer the time grid of the correct OU:

  • If you are planning a follow-up visit, this is the OU defined by the parameter WIDB_ORGID.

  • If you are planning an appointment for requested or preregistered services, this is the first OU in the tab page sequence, which can perform the services.

    With parameter N1PTRCHS you define whether the system should propose this correct OU when a patient is highlighted in the worklist - using the Select Patient pushbutton - and not only when the planning grid is called. It is not sufficient to focus on the patient in the worklist.

As standard the planning grid will assume the value of the parameter is X, which means that it will propose the correct tab page when a patient is highlighted.

Example Example

Two patients with preregistrations appear in the worklist of the planning grid. The services of the first patient can be performed by the CT Outpatient Clinic OU. The services of the second patient can be performed by the US Outpatient Clinic OU. As standard, the first patient of the worklist is selected. The system will propose the CT Outpatient Clinic OU in the time grid.

If you then select the second patient using the Select Patient pushbutton, the system will change the proposed OU in the time grid to the US Outpatient Clinic.

End of the example.
N1PTRNO

With this parameter you can determine how many organizational units the system can simultaneously display in the time grid of the planning grid. You define the parameter for the planning OU.

For a resolution of 1024x768 pixels and a 17 inch monitor, we recommend 4 – 7 organizational units.

Note Note

This system will not take this parameter into account when calling the planning grid with display variants, since the setting is made in the display variant.

End of the note.
N1PTSBZT

Using this parameter you can define the earliest point in time which can be reached by scrolling in the time grid of the planning grid.

You should enter the desired time using the following format: HH:MM (two-digit entry of hours and minutes, separated by a colon).

N1PTSEZT

Using this parameter you can define the latest point in time which can be reached by scrolling in the time grid of the planning grid.

You should enter the desired time using the following format: HH:MM (two-digit entry of hours and minutes, separated by a colon).

N1PTSRVSH

You can use this parameter to choose whether the system should (Display All Services) or (Only Display Plannable Services) in the worklist of the planning grid.

See Tab Page on Item Level

The system will check the parameter value for the planning organizational unit.

  • All services (standard value)

  • Only plannable services

    Note Note

    This function is available to you if you have activated the business function Clinical System Situation-Based Clinical Documentation (ISHMED_SCD).

    End of the note.
N1PTSRVSO

You use this parameter to control how the services in the worklist of the planning grid should be sorted. The system will check the parameter value for the planning organizational unit.

  • By ordered service (standard value)

  • chronologically

This function is available to you if you have activated the business function Clinical System Situation-Based Clinical Documentation (ISHMED_SCD).

N1PTTAGE

You store the time period to be displayed in this OU parameter. You define the parameter for the planning OU.

As the parameter value, you enter the number of days which should be displayed. All values greater than or equal to 1 are valid. One day is used as the standard value.

Note Note

This system will not take this parameter into account when calling the planning grid with display variants, since the setting is made in the display variant.

End of the note.
N1PTTMNR

You use this parameter to determine which time grid should be used in the planning grid to plan appointments in the planning grid. The value corresponds to the entry in minutes.

Example Example

A value of 10 means that you can set appointments in a 10 minute grid for the relevant OU and for all subsequent resources.

End of the example.
N1PTTMNZT

You use this OU parameter to determine whether the system should adapt the start time of the time grid (according to OU parameter N1PTTMNR) or the time slot when creating an appointment by double-clicking in an area with planning authority and a time slot in the time grid of the planning grid.

You can find detailed information in the input help for the OU parameter.

N1PTVNP

This parameter determines whether the system should automatically exit the planning grid once you have planned the last entry in the worklist.

  • X: Exit planning grid

  • Space: Do not exit planning grid (standard )

N1LSLIST

You can use this parameter to control whether the system should display the service code or the service description.

When several services are displayed, the system will separate the service texts using commas.

  • 1: Display service code

  • 2. Display service description (standard value)

N1PLCO

You can use this parameter to control the appearance of clinical orders in the worklists of the planning grid and day-based planning:

  • 1: All items of a clinical order area visible in the worklist (standard value).

  • 2: The system only displays the clinical order items that you selected before calling the planning grid or day-based planning.

The system will check the parameter value for the following organizational unit (OU):

  • In the planning grid, for the planning OU

  • In day-based planning, for the OU to be planned (as no planning OU exists).

N1COLLBWDR

You use this parameter to define fan average duration of movement for the planning grid and the patient appointment calendar, which

  • the system uses as the duration of the movement in the Patient’s Planned Appointment area in the planning grid, if the movement is not connected with an appointment.

  • the system takes into account during the appointment clash check of a patient. Note that the collision clash check also takes into account unplanned visits. The system will use a duration of 2 hours as standard.

The system checks the parameter value for the OU at which the visit will take place.

N1PTDBAPPH

You use this parameter to control how high you wish to display an individual day-based appointment (in pixels) in the vertical display of the day-based appointments in the day-based area of the planning grid for the planning OU.

The value of 480 (standard value) is used as a guideline value.

Note Note

The user parameter N1PT_DBA_HEIGHT overrides this OU parameter.

End of the note.

Integration

N1TMDISP

With this parameter, you can specify the planning tool which the system should call as standard. This parameter affects follow-up appointments.

  • 1: IS-H scheduling will be called as the planning tool (standard value)

  • 2: i.s.h.med: Planning grid will be called as the planning tool

Create this parameter for the corresponding organizational unit for each planning variant:

  • for a visit for the nursing OU of the visit

  • for an appointment for the OU for which the appointment is planned

  • for a service for the performing OU of the service

N1DISP

You use this parameter to decide whether the system calls the team entry function or the planning grid in the following cases:

  • Use of the Time hotspot in the Outpatient Clinic/Service Facility view type

  • Call of the Confirm Request function

The system calls the planning grid if you set this parameter to P.

You create this parameter for the planning OU.

Note Note

To control the call of the planning grid in the clinical order, use parameter N1VKGPLVIS. For more information, see Organizational Unit-Related Parameters for Clinical Orders.

End of the note.
WIDB_ORGID

With this parameter you can specify which OU the follow-up visit should be planned for. If this parameter is not maintained, the system will create the follow-up appointment for the calling OU.

You can find out the valid entries using the input help.

OE_DISPTYP

The user should be able to create appointments for times outside of the day program, but within his planning authority, by double-clicking.

To use this function in the planning grid you should maintain the parameter OE_DISPTYP, which provides the scheduling type of the treatment OU.

Caution Caution

You should note that you must change the value of this parameter from the date when you introduce a new scheduling type and declare the previous scheduling type used to be invalid.

End of the caution.

Note the following procedure for the presetting of the scheduling type:

  • Appointment allocation and surgery planning in i.s.h.med takes the scheduling type to be used for an appointment from the parameter OE_DISPTYP, provided that the scheduling type is not preset otherwise, for example, on the basis of the time slot.

  • Presetting is made once, i.e. if you remove the preset scheduling type, the system does not preset the value again. The system only presets the scheduling type if you have not selected any other scheduling type.

    Caution Caution

    Note the following exception:

    If, when changing an appointment, you choose a different treatment OU or other date, the scheduling type is only preset, if you do not select a different scheduling type.

    End of the caution.
  • If the value of the OU parameter OE_DISPTYP is invalid or not maintained, the system uses the first valid scheduling type from the table of Scheduling Types.

  • If you reschedule an existing appointment without dialog in such a way that the treatment OU changes and the scheduling type becomes invalid, the system presets the scheduling type with the value of the parameter OE_DISPTYP.

  • If you double-click a free time area in the planning grid and the scheduling type is missing, the system presets the scheduling type with the value of the parameter OE_DISPTYP.

OU Parameters for Plan Release
  • N1CSCHG

    You use this parameter to define whether a reason is required when you release a plan.

  • N1CSCHGTXT

    You use this parameter to define whether the entry of a reason comes from customizing or from the free text.

  • N1RLSPDIA

    You use this parameter to define whether the plan should be released with or without a dialog.

  • N1CSCHGDEF

    You use this parameter to determine which change reason (table N1CSCHG) is used as standard as the change reason for the relevant organizational unit (OU).
